Poking around the Archives of Nethys, I haven't seen anything that puts a lower limit on a check, attack roll, or saving throw. It's always "you succeed if you get (this number) or higher"; sometimes 1 and 20 auto fail/succeed.
Damage rolls have a minimum of 1 nonlethal, which is mostly reflected in your Shield Bash example. Hope this helps. |
